文章 2024-08-16 来自:开发者社区

LeetCode第86题分隔链表

继续打卡算法题,今天学习的是第86题分隔链表,这道题目是道中等题。算法题的一些解题思路和技巧真的非常巧妙,每天看一看算法题和解题思路,我相信对我们的编码思维和编码能力有一些提升。 分析一波题目 本题,我们将使用两个链表,一个记录小于x的节点,一个记录大于等于x的节点,最后合并两个链表就解决了,这个办法是容易想到的方法。 本题解题技巧 1、构造两个新链表分别记录小于x的节点和大于等于x...

LeetCode第86题分隔链表
文章 2024-08-05 来自:开发者社区

【Leetcode刷题Python】86.分隔链表

1 题目 给你一个链表的头节点 head 和一个特定值 x ,请你对链表进行分隔,使得所有 小于 x 的节点都出现在 大于或等于 x 的节点之前。你不需要 保留 每个分区中各节点的初始相对位置。 2 解析 初始化两个空节点,dummy1和dummy2,分别存储小于x的元素和大于等于x的元素。遍历链表,将所有小于x的元素链接到dummy1上,将大于等于x的链接到dummy2上,最后给dumm...

【Leetcode刷题Python】86.分隔链表
文章 2024-06-10 来自:开发者社区

LeetCode 题目 86:分隔链表

作者介绍:10年大厂数据\经营分析经验,现任大厂数据部门负责人。 会一些的技术:数据分析、算法、SQL、大数据相关、python 欢迎加入社区:码上找工作 作者专栏每日更新: LeetCode解锁1000题: 打怪升级之旅 python数据分析可视化:企业实战案例 python源码解读 程序员必备的数学知识与应用 ...

文章 2024-01-15 来自:开发者社区

leetcode-86:分隔链表

$stringUtil.substring( $!{XssContent1.description},200)...

leetcode-86:分隔链表
文章 2024-01-12 来自:开发者社区

golang力扣leetcode 86.分隔链表

题解思路:将大于 x 的节点,放到另外一个链表,最后连接这两个链表代码package main type ListNode struct { Val int Next *ListNode } func partition(head *ListNode, x int) *ListNode { if head == nil { return nil } headDumm...

文章 2023-11-20 来自:开发者社区

【LeetCode力扣】86. 分隔链表

 1、题目介绍原题链接:86. 分隔链表 - 力扣(LeetCode)示例 1:输入:head = [1,4,3,2,5,2], x = 3输出:[1,2,2,4,3,5]示例 2:输入:head = [2,1], x = 2输出:[1,2...

【LeetCode力扣】86. 分隔链表
文章 2023-11-20 来自:开发者社区

LeetCode刷题之分隔链表(图解➕代码)

 首先直接进入主题,题目链接🔗力扣(LeetCode)官网 - 全球极客挚爱的技术成长平台源代码在最后,有更优解的朋友欢迎在评论里指导我一番!1.题目分析通过题目分析得出结论:        1. 将链表分为k个子链表        2. 用一个数组存放这k个子链表,数组的长度就是k...

LeetCode刷题之分隔链表(图解➕代码)
文章 2023-10-25 来自:开发者社区

【Leetcode -328.奇偶链表 - 725.分隔链表】

Leetcode -328.奇偶链表题目:给定单链表的头节点 head ,将所有索引为奇数的节点和索引为偶数的节点分别组合在一起,然后返回重新排序的列表。第一个节点的索引被认为是 奇数 , 第二个节点的索引为 偶数 ,以此类推。请注意,偶数组和奇数组内部的相对顺序应该与输入时保持一致。你必须在 O(1) 的额外空...

【Leetcode -328.奇偶链表 - 725.分隔链表】
文章 2023-10-25 来自:开发者社区

【Leetcode -86.分隔链表 -92.反转链表Ⅱ】

Leetcode -86.分隔链表题目:给你一个链表的头节点 head 和一个特定值 x ,请你对链表进行分隔,使得所有 小于 x 的节点都出现在 大于或等于 x 的节点之前。你应当 保留 两个分区中每个节点的初始相对位置。示例 1:输入:head = [1, 4, 3, 2, 5, 2], x = 3输出&#...

【Leetcode -86.分隔链表 -92.反转链表Ⅱ】
文章 2022-10-10 来自:开发者社区

[链表]leetcode725-分隔链表(C++)

给你一个链表的头节点 head 和一个特定值 x ,请你对链表进行分隔,使得所有 小于 x 的节点都出现在 大于或等于 x 的节点之前。你应当 保留 两个分区中每个节点的初始相对位置。示例 1:输入:head = [1,4,3,2,5,2], x = 3输出:[1,2,2,4,3,5]示例2: 输...

[链表]leetcode725-分隔链表(C++)

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

算法编程

开发者社区在线编程频道官方技术圈。包含算法资源更新,周赛动态,每日一题互动。

+关注